Block

#21,502,119
Block Number
21,502,119 @ 04/25/2025, 03:05:10
Status
Finalized
ID
0x014818a7c72b7a3ac4fc8c5b29857ed1cd9d89d9896112455ccbb7a9bb3bdcbf
Transactions
Gas Used
561072/40000000 (1.40% Used)
Total Score
2,099,727,480 (+99)
Rewards
1.68 VTHO